This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] BQ40Z80:无法将 BQStudio 与 BQ40Z80连接

Guru**** 2540720 points
Other Parts Discussed in Thread: BQ40Z80, BQSTUDIO, EV2400

请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/power-management-group/power-management/f/power-management-forum/1217461/bq40z80-can-not-connect-bqstudio-with-bq40z80

器件型号:BQ40Z80
主题中讨论的其他器件: BQSTUDIOEV2400

大家好、

我最近收到了定制的 BQ40Z80 PCB、但不尝试与它们通信。 昨天我能够与其中一个器件通信、并更改了引脚配置和电芯配置。 今天上午、当我尝试打开 BQStudio 应用程序时、但设备无法连接到应用程序。

应用确实会自动检测芯片并打开应用、但应用打开后、电压为65534mV、电流在-8191、0和8191之间波动。 任何刷新或扫描的尝试都会向我显示错误、"No Acknowledge by device (器件未确认)"。 我使用的是6S 配置、并使用 BQ40Z80EVM 板上的 BQStudio 和 EV2400的测试版本。 这是 BQStudio 的仪表板图像。 我使用一个夹子而不是 EVM 上的 WAKE 按钮将 Bat+短接至 Pack+、一旦断开夹子、我的电路板就会断开连接。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好 Bhavil:

    TI EVM 是否可以正常工作? 如果没有、则 EV2400可能有问题

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    尊敬的 Shirish:

    是的、EVM 可以正常工作。 我确实确定了定制 PCB 不能正常工作的问题。 这是因为 BQ40Z80的引脚10和11处的热敏电阻未连接。 我创建了一些连接了热敏电阻的新电路板、并且它们正在工作

    然而、之前创建的两个板不能正常工作(由于我提出了这个问题、板)、甚至在添加热敏电阻后也无法工作。 您是否知道这里可能发生了什么?

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    尝试将默认 srec 编程到非工作板。 您可以从正常工作的设备中读出它。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    Sirish、您好!  

    当我尝试更新固件时、会显示以下错误"Program Srec:数据包校验和不匹配"

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好 Bhavil:

    读取字0xD、如果该值大于100、请重试。 如果不能恢复、则可能更难恢复或无法恢复。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    尊敬的 Shirish:

    当我读取字0xD 时、返回的十六进制值是0000 (请参阅随附的图片)。 我也对工作 EVM 执行了相同的操作、它返回0056。 此命令的作用是什么?

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好 Bhavil:

    这会以百分比的形式读取剩余容量。 最大值为100。 如果返回大于100的值、则电量监测计未编程或编程时出错。

    根据您的检查、对电量监测计进行编程。 您唯一可以做的是尝试对 srec 重复编程。 如果它成功编程一次、那么它将恢复。 另一种替代尝试方法是通过导入默认值和 Write All 来将默认值写入数据闪存。 如果操作成功、则将提高成功对 srec 编程的机会。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    感谢 Shirish 的帮助

    我将尝试一下、并对您进行更新。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    尊敬的 Shirish:

    导入默认值对我不起作用、因为我只能导入默认值。 但无法写入、因为"Write All"按钮对我而言呈灰色显示。 对 srec 进行编程不起作用、因此正如前面提到的、它只会抛出"Program srec:数据包校验和不匹配"错误。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好 Bhavil、在这种情况下、通信问题正在阻止恢复。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    感谢您抽出宝贵时间参加 Shirish 培训、

    我想这个问题只是特定于电路板的、因为一些其他电路板使用类似的配置。